"On September 13, 2018, 240 volunteers from The Home Depot Foundation will work on a variety of projects at Hope and Healing at Hillenglade (HHH), a nonprofit and equine farm in Nashville that serves our Armed Forces, Veterans, First Responders and their families. Volunteers will complete 20 different projects at HHH, including installing siding, doors and windows on multiple structures, building benches and picnic tables, constructing an above ground pond and landscaping. All of HHH’s programming is completely free of charge for Veterans and their families, and includes Family Celebration Events and Equine-Assisted Sessions & Programs, such as their new Empowerment Transition Program, which offers two female Veterans and/or First Responders the opportunity to live at HHH for a three-month period to focus on their personal growth, encouragement and well-being while gaining vocational skills in horse care as they move into the next chapter of their lives. In order to accomplish the long list of projects on September 13, Hope and Healing at Hillenglade, The Home Depot Foundation and Hands On Nashville request the support of volunteer leaders from The Mission Continues on the day of the project. Hands On Nashville will train volunteer leaders to help ensure the scope of work is completed by the volunteers."
